Norway`s veterinary parasiticides import market saw significant growth in 2024, with top exporting countries being the UK, Germany, USA, Denmark, and Metropolitan France. Despite the strong growth rate of 27.79% in 2024, the market remains relatively unconcentrated with a low Herfindahl-Hirschman Index (HHI). The compound annual growth rate (CAGR) from 2020 to 2024 stands at 3.86%, indicating a steady upward trend in import shipments of veterinary parasiticides. This data suggests a healthy and competitive market landscape for veterinary parasiticides in Norway.
